Worcester Live, in association with the Elgar School of Music, Worcester Concert Club and Ian Venables, presents:
 ‘Lest We Forget’ - 
A commemorative concert to mark the end of the Great War 

With James Gilchrist (tenor), Benjamin Frith (piano) and Richard Jenkinson (‘cello).

This celebrity song recital has been devised to mark the centenary of the end of WW1. Featuring some of Britain’s best loved songs by Vaughan Williams, Butterworth, Gurney and Finzi, the concert will also include a performance of Ian Venables’ powerful and moving song cycle Through These Pale Cold Days, which was commissioned by the Limoges Trust for the City of Worcester. This work was premiered in 2016 and is dedicated to the memory of the Worcestershire Regiment and the Old Boys of the Royal Grammar School, Worcester.
